Descripción

In this episode, the hosts discuss the unique challenges faced by educators who also have demands of their time outside of school. They share personal experiences and practical strategies for balancing the challenges of teaching with family responsibilities. The conversation emphasizes the importance of setting boundaries, prioritizing self-care, and building a supportive community among colleagues. Listeners are encouraged to implement these strategies to create a healthier work-life balance and to seek support when needed.

Herd Spotlight: AVID

In this episode of the Bison Byte podcast, Rich Abram and Colleen Fitzgerald discuss the AVID program at Woodbury City Public Schools. They explore the impact of AVID on student engagement and success, Colleen's extensive educational journey, the target audience for AVID, and the school's recognition as a national demonstration school. They also highlight the importance of professional development and support for teachers in implementing AVID strategies effectively. In this conversation, Rich and Colleen discuss the transformative power of AVID in education, emphasizing the importance of in-person connections, gradual student growth, and the development of essential skills such as open-mindedness and empathy. They share success stories of students who have thrived through AVID programs and provide practical teaching strategies that can be easily implemented in classrooms. The discussion also touches on personal passions and the impact of educational experiences on student representation and leadership.

Herd Spotlight: Social Workers - The Heart of Our Schools

This podcast episode celebrates National School Social Worker Week by highlighting the vital roles of social workers in the Woodbury School community. The conversation explores the challenges students face today, practical strategies for teachers to support their students, and the importance of self-care for social workers. The episode emphasizes the need for supportive environments for both students and staff, showcasing the collaborative efforts of social workers in fostering a nurturing educational atmosphere. In this engaging conversation, educators discuss the complexities of their roles, the importance of creating safe spaces for students and teachers, and the power of perspective in helping students envision their futures. They reflect on their aspirations, the superpowers they wish they had to support their students, and the significance of their work in the community.
